首页 / 国外VPS推荐 / 正文
中间件服务器企业级应用架构的核心引擎与运维实践

Time:2025年03月21日 Read:3 评论:0 作者:y21dr45

在数字化转型浪潮中,"中间件服务器"作为支撑现代企业级系统的隐形支柱,其重要性日益凸显。根据IDC最新报告显示:全球中间件市场规模将在2025年突破650亿美元大关;在中国市场头部金融企业的IT架构中,平均每套核心系统部署超过15种不同类型的中间件服务。这些数据揭示了一个重要事实——在分布式架构主导的云时代背景下,"中间件服务器"已成为构建高可用性业务系统的关键技术基石。

中间件服务器企业级应用架构的核心引擎与运维实践

一、深度解析:中间件服务器的技术定位与核心价值

1.1 基础架构中的战略定位

中间件服务器(Middleware Server)位于操作系统与应用软件之间层级的特殊服务集群体系。它不同于传统的Web服务器或数据库服务器直接处理业务请求的特性:

- 协议转换中枢:实现HTTP/HTTPS到AMQP/MQTT等异构协议的智能转换

- 流量调度中心:通过动态路由策略分配请求到后端服务节点

- 事务协调器:在分布式环境下保证ACID特性的事务一致性

- 安全屏障:提供统一的身份认证与访问控制入口

典型的技术栈包括Apache Tomcat(Web容器)、RabbitMQ(消息队列)、Redis Cluster(缓存集群)等组件构成的复合型服务体系。

1.2 关键能力维度分析

现代中间件的技术能力矩阵已突破传统ESB(企业服务总线)的范畴:

- 微服务治理:支持Spring Cloud/Dubbo框架的服务注册发现机制

- 智能弹性伸缩:基于Prometheus监控指标的自动扩缩容策略

- 多活容灾:实现跨AZ/Region级别的流量切换与数据同步

- 灰度发布:通过Canary Release机制降低版本更新风险

某头部电商平台的实战数据显示:通过优化Kafka消息队列的分区策略后订单处理吞吐量提升237%,延迟降低至原水平的18%。这充分证明了合理配置的中间件集群对业务性能的关键影响。

二、生产环境中的关键运维场景与解决方案

2.1 高可用架构设计模式

在金融级生产环境中需采用多层级高可用方案:

```

HA Architecture:

├─ L4 Load Balancer (Keepalived + HAProxy)

│ ├─ Active Node: Virtual IP 192.168.1.100

│ └─ Standby Node: Virtual IP 192.168.1.101

├─ Middleware Cluster (3 Nodes)

│ ├─ Node1: ZooKeeper Leader

│ ├─ Node2: ZooKeeper Follower

│ └─ Node3: ZooKeeper Observer

└─ Storage Layer (Ceph RBD with Replica=3)

该架构实现了从接入层到存储层的全链路冗余设计:

- VIP漂移保证接入层持续可用

- ZAB协议确保集群选举快速完成(平均故障转移时间<200ms)

- Ceph的CRUSH算法自动修复数据副本

2.2 JVM深度调优实践

针对Java系中间件的GC优化是性能调优的重点:

```bash

Tomcat启动参数示例(JDK11+)

JAVA_OPTS="-Xms8g -Xmx8g

-XX:+UseZGC

-XX:MaxGCPauseMillis=100

-XX:ConcGCThreads=4

-Xlog:gc*:file=/var/log/gc.log"

关键参数解析:

- ZGC替代传统的G1收集器以应对大内存场景

- MaxGCPauseMillis控制STW时间在100ms内

- ConcGCThreads根据物理CPU核数动态调整

某银行核心系统通过调整JVM参数后Full GC频率从每小时3次降为每周1次, YGC持续时间缩短82%。

三、云原生时代的演进方向与技术预判

3.1 Service Mesh的技术融合趋势

Istio等Service Mesh技术正在重塑传统中间件的形态:

Service Mesh Architecture:

┌──────────────────────┐

│ Application Layer │

├──────────────────────┤

│ Envoy Sidecar │←── Service Discovery

├──────────────────────┤ Traffic Management

│ Control Plane │←── Policy Enforcement

└──────────────────────┘ Telemetry Collection

这种Sidecar模式将传统集中式中间件的功能下沉到每个Pod中:

- API网关能力由Envoy代理实现

- Tracing数据通过Jaeger Agent采集

- RBAC策略由OPA引擎动态下发

3.2 AIOps驱动的智能运维体系构建建议:

```mermaid

graph LR

A[Prometheus Exporter] --> B[Time Series DB]

B --> C[Anomaly Detection Model]

C --> D[Auto-Remediation Engine]

D --> E[Kubernetes Operator]

该闭环系统实现了:

- Prometheus实时采集200+项性能指标

- LSTM模型预测资源瓶颈(准确率>92%)

- Operator自动执行Horizontal Pod Autoscaler

某运营商的实际案例显示:引入AIOps后故障MTTR从小时级缩短至分钟级,年度运维成本降低1200万元。

四、结语:构建面向未来的弹性基础设施

当我们将视角投向2025年后的技术演进时,"可观测性"与"自愈能力"将成为衡量中间件平台成熟度的新标准。《IEEE Software》最新研究指出:具备深度学习能力的自适应中间件系统可将异常检测效率提升40倍以上。对于企业技术决策者而言——投资建设具备弹性伸缩能力和智能诊断功能的现代化中间件平台已不再是选择题而是必答题——这将是支撑未来十年业务创新的数字基座。(字数统计:1587字)

TAG:中间件服务器,中间件服务器价格,中间件服务器连接失败,中间件服务器和应用服务器的区别,中间件服务器重启需要多久

标签:
排行榜
关于我们
「好主机」服务器测评网专注于为用户提供专业、真实的服务器评测与高性价比推荐。我们通过硬核性能测试、稳定性追踪及用户真实评价,帮助企业和个人用户快速找到最适合的服务器解决方案。无论是云服务器、物理服务器还是企业级服务器,好主机都是您值得信赖的选购指南!
快捷菜单1
服务器测评
VPS测评
VPS测评
服务器资讯
服务器资讯
扫码关注
鲁ICP备2022041413号-1